To where it bent in … WebLadies and gentlemen, this is High Wood, Called by the French, Bois des Furneaux, The famous spot which in Nineteen-Sixteen, July, August and September was the scene. Of long and bitterly contested strife, By reason of its High commanding site. Observe the effect of shell-fire in the trees. Standing and fallen; here is wire; this trench.
